Description
Torridge District Council requires a mixture of split body Refuse Collection Vehicles, to be used in providing the Kerbside recycling service. Split bodies are required as there is a requirement to collect glass separately from other materials presented for recycling. The contract will be for the provision of five 70/30 Split body Recycling Collection Vehicles through Contract Hire to Torridge District Council. Because of the diverse nature of the services provided by TDC and the importance of the services being delivered on time, within set standards, whilst achieving best value, TDC will require the Contractor to supply both the vehicles and their accompanying maintenance, repair and servicing (where applicable) to the highest possible standards. The strategic importance of certain vehicles places a high demand on the Authority to ensure that the level of service is kept at the highest possible standard throughout the contract period. This is a two lot tender: • Lot A is for hire only • Lot B is for hire and maintenance.
